From: Chao Yu <chao@kernel.org>
commit 0eda086de85e140f53c6123a4c00662f4e614ee4 upstream.
Sysfs entry name is gc_pin_file_thresh instead of gc_pin_file_threshold,
fix it.
Cc: stable@kernel.org
Fixes: c521a6ab4ad7 ("f2fs: fix to limit gc_pin_file_threshold")
Signed-off-by: Chao Yu <chao@kernel.org>
Signed-off-by: Jaegeuk Kim <jaegeuk@kernel.org>
Signed-off-by: Greg Kroah-Hartman <gregkh@linuxfoundation.org>
---
fs/f2fs/sysfs.c | 2 +-
1 file changed, 1 insertion(+), 1 deletion(-)
--- a/fs/f2fs/sysfs.c
+++ b/fs/f2fs/sysfs.c
@@ -749,7 +749,7 @@ out:
return count;
}
- if (!strcmp(a->attr.name, "gc_pin_file_threshold")) {
+ if (!strcmp(a->attr.name, "gc_pin_file_thresh")) {
if (t > MAX_GC_FAILED_PINNED_FILES)
return -EINVAL;
sbi->gc_pin_file_threshold = t;
